Monsoon rains flood Mandaluyong, Parañaque — MMDA
At the EDSA Shaw tunnel northbound in Mandaluyong, floodwaters reached gutter-deep but remained passable to all types of vehicles.
In Parañaque, Dr. A. Santos Avenue at 4th Estate, Barangay San Antonio, was half-tire deep and not passable to light vehicles going northbound.
MMDA urged motorists to take precautions and monitor updates for road conditions.
